WebIn addition to representing identifiable individual difference variables, genetic associations with pain can reveal specific biological mechanisms that contribute to pain responses. Key-Point 10: Multi-Modal Analgesia. The pain pathway is complex, with multiple neurotransmitters and receptors involved in the transmission of noxious information from the periphery to the central nervous system and cortex. It is therefore extremely difficult to achieve effective analgesia by using a single class of analgesic drug alone.
